This is a powerful Havan that invokes all the gods and is performed to overcome obstacles, conquer hurdles, and prevent legal problems. Other benefits of this powerful Havan include:
- Wealth
- Health
- Prosperity
- Protection
- Marital bliss
- Good education and spiritual knowledge
- Healthy children
- Peace
- Enlightenment
This Havan starts with a Ganesh Havan, then a Karthikeya Havan, a Mother Divine Havan, a Rudra Havan, a Navagraha Shanthi Havan (the nine planets), and the gods for the eight directions.
Everyone whose name is read during this Havan can also have three wishes read in Sanskrit during this ceremony.
